Popular YouTuber Billy LeBlanc, known for his channel with over 200,000 subscribers, recently shared sad news with his followers. In an emotional update posted on July 16, LeBlanc revealed that his girlfriend, Natalie Clark, had passed away following a severe illness caused by consuming contaminated raw oysters, according to Indy 100.
LeBlanc explained that both he and Clark were sickened after eating oysters together. LeBlanc endured a lengthy 12-day hospital stay, including eight days in the intensive care unit. When he woke up,LeBlanc learned Clark had passed away. He admits to having little memory of this time, stating he was “out of it” for most of his hospitalization.
In a heartfelt tribute to Clark, LeBlanc shared fond memories of their time together, saying, “I will always remember how we got lost everywhere together. I will always love her and miss her.” He urged his followers to cherish their loved ones and stay safe.
LeBlanc later clarified that their illness was caused by Vibrio vulnificus, a rare but serious bacterial infection associated with consuming raw or undercooked shellfish. This infection affects approximately 100 to 200 people annually in the United States. According to the U.S. Centers for Disease Control (CDC), as many as one in five people with a Vibrio vulnificus die due to rapidly escalating symptoms like bloodstream infections, severe skin blistering, and limb amputations.
